Summary

The Clippers' training camp revealed some hidden dangers, including players slacking off after winning two consecutive championships. Griffin, Chandler, Parsons, and Fa Li De were not as diligent in training as they were last season. Only Ku Li had high morale, with a clear personal goal to prove himself stronger than Paul and win the regular season MVP again. Veteran Nash's condition was not good, and his defense was too poor, making him a black hole on the court. Yang Rui had a private conversation with Nash, who didn't demand playing time and didn't feel embarrassed about being a marginal player. Yang Rui planned to let Nash rest during the preseason and reduce his training intensity. The U16 Asian Youth Championship ended, with the Chinese men's basketball team winning the championship with a perfect record. Hu Jin Qiu performed impressively, scoring 20.6 points, 12.9 rebounds, and 4.2 blocks per game. Yang Rui's prestige in China soared, and he received widespread praise for his investment in the Chinese team's training. The NBA preseason began, and the Clippers played seriously in the two games in China, winning both games. The core players have already familiarized themselves with the tactics from last season. The newcomers just need some time to adjust. The Clippers achieved a record of 6 wins and 1 loss in the preseason. Rudy Gay and Chandler Parsons were the best performers, aside from the two All-Stars. Experts analyzed that the Clippers' defense is stronger than last season, with a super defensive center in the paint, a versatile power forward skilled in pick-and-rolls, a wing player adept at defending against drives, and a point guard tall enough to disrupt shots. The Clippers can always collapse into the paint defensively, limiting smaller opponents' drives and bigger players' post-ups. The first official power rankings were released, with the Clippers taking the top spot. The regular season kicks off on November 29, with the highly anticipated Western Conference opener featuring the Clippers hosting the Lakers in the Los Angeles derby.
